• <sub id="h4knl"><ol id="h4knl"></ol></sub>
    <sup id="h4knl"></sup>
      <sub id="h4knl"></sub>

      <sub id="h4knl"><ol id="h4knl"><em id="h4knl"></em></ol></sub><s id="h4knl"></s>
      1. <strong id="h4knl"></strong>

      2. javascript數據創建方法參考

        時間:2024-07-30 19:00:57 JavaScript 我要投稿
        • 相關推薦

        javascript數據創建方法參考

          在JavaScript中,創建一個數組可以使用 new Array,如下幾種語法都是正確的:

          arrayObj = new Array()創建一個數組。

          arrayObj = new Array([size])創建一個數組并指定長度,注意不是上限,是長度。

          arrayObj = new Array([element0[, element1[, ...[, elementN]]]])創建一個數組并賦值。

          arrayObj = [element0, element1, ..., elementN]創建一個數組并賦值的簡寫,注意這里中括號不表示可省略。

          要說明的是,雖然第二種方法創建數組指定了長度,但實際上所有情況下數組都是變長的,也就是說即使指定了長度為5,仍然可以將元素存儲在規定長度以外的,注意:這時長度會隨之改變。

          new Array(5) 是指創建一個長度為5的數組還是創建一個元素值為5的數組?創建一個長度為5的數組。

          數組下標是從0開始還是從1開始?從0開始,所以數組的上限等于數組的長度-1。

          數組下標的最大值是多少?2的32次方再減2,即4294967295,大約40億,夠用吧。

          數組下標為小數時會自動取整嗎?不會,將忽略或發生運行時錯誤。

          支持多維數組嗎?不支持!不過可以將數組的每個元素再定義為數組,以達到多維數組的目的。

          如何訪問數組元素?使用“[]”,比如數組名為arr,要訪問第一個元素,就使用arr[0]。

          JavaScript數組 (JScript 版本 2)共有3個屬性、13個方法。3個屬性中只有length是比較重要的 ,但比較簡單,另外 constructor 與 prototype 屬性是 object 共有的且不常用,所以對 Array 屬性不作介紹,而對Array的13個方法分組介紹,便于記憶。

          pop 與 push:pop 移除最后一個元素并返回該元素值;push([item1 [item2 [. . . [itemN ]]]])將一個或多個新元素添加到數組結尾,并返回數組新長度,如果添加的是數組則先用逗號將該數組的各元素連接起來再添加。

          shift 與 unshift:分別對應于 pop 和 push,只是這是在數組的開始位置進行。注意當從開始位置移除或添加元素時,會將數組中的元素前移或后移。

          slice 與 splice:slice(start, [end])以數組的形式返回數組的一部分,注意不包括 end 對應的元素,如果省略 end 將復制 start 之后的所有元素;splice(start, Count, [item1[, item2[, . . . [,itemN]]]])移除數組一個或多個元素,如果必要,在所移除元素的位置上插入新元素,數組形式返回所移除的元素,如果插入的是數組,則只插入數組的第一個元素。

          reverse 與 sort:reverse() 反轉元素(最前的排到最后、最后的排到最前),并且返回數組地址;sort()對數組排序并且返回數組地址。

          concat 與 join:concat 將多個數組(也可以是字符串)連接為一個數組;join(separator)返回字符串,這個字符串將數組的每一個元素值連接在一起,中間用 separator 隔開。

          toLocaleString 、toString 、valueOf:可以看作是join的特殊用法,不常用。

        【javascript數據創建方法參考】相關文章:

        JavaScript常用方法匯總10-25

        關于數據類型的Javascript學習筆記08-05

        JavaScript數組常用方法介紹09-04

        javascript跨域訪問的方法07-09

        javascript編程異常處理的方法08-04

        JavaScript fontcolor方法入門實例07-07

        使用ajax操作JavaScript對象的方法09-28

        詳解JavaScript中的splice()使用方法08-20

        關于javascript尋找錯誤方法整理05-23

        最常用的20個javascript方法函數09-10

        国产高潮无套免费视频_久久九九兔免费精品6_99精品热6080YY久久_国产91久久久久久无码
      3. <sub id="h4knl"><ol id="h4knl"></ol></sub>
        <sup id="h4knl"></sup>
          <sub id="h4knl"></sub>

          <sub id="h4knl"><ol id="h4knl"><em id="h4knl"></em></ol></sub><s id="h4knl"></s>
          1. <strong id="h4knl"></strong>

          2. 亚洲中文成人字幕 | 亚洲成a人v电影在线点播 | 亚洲综合区第二页 | 亚洲一区二区三区自拍天堂 | 日韩新片免费专区在线观看 | 亚洲欧洲精品成人久久曰影片 |